/************************************************************************************
|
||||
// class template GenData
|
||||
// Iteratates a TypeList, and invokes the functor GenFunc<T>
|
||||
// for each type in the list, passing a functor along the way.
|
||||
// The functor is designed to be an insertion iterator which GenFunc<T>
|
||||
// can use to output information about the types in the list.
|
||||
//
|
||||
|
||||
Example Use
|
||||
|
||||
template<typename T>
|
||||
struct ExtractDataType
|
||||
{
|
||||
some_type operator()()
|
||||
{
|
||||
return create_value_from_type<T>;
|
||||
}
|
||||
};
|
||||
|
||||
Loki::GenData<parameter_tl, ExtractDataType> gen;
|
||||
std::vector<user_defined_type> stuff;
|
||||
gen(std::back_inserter(stuff));
|
||||
*******************************************************************************/
